This rare antique CONTA BOEHME fairing, entitled COME AWAY THESE FLOWERS DONT SMELL VERY GOOD was made in Possneck, Germany and dates back to 1860. Amuzing mottos such as this one were characteristic of these early German solid paste porcelains. The base has a continuous ridge and the early markings in its base shows it is an early example of a German made fairing.One like it is pictured in the publication \'Victorian China Fairing\'s by Derek H. Jordan on page 54.
